Published On: Fri, Feb 3rd, 2023

The UK’s most loved landmark is in London but so is its most disliked – full list

From York Minster to Blackpool Tower, the UK has some iconic landmarks. But there’s a few that tourists particularly like and a couple that are less popular.
Daily Express :: Travel Feed

Comments are closed.

Most Popular Posts

Categories